Kir
An easy aperitif cocktail built on aperitif.
The Recipe
- white wine5 oz
- crème de cassis0.5 oz

Common Questions
- What ingredients do I need for a Kir?
- 5 oz white wine, 0.5 oz crème de cassis.
- How much does a Kir cost to make at home?
- The estimated pour cost for a Kir is $2.37 using standard US retail bottle prices.
- How many calories are in a Kir?
- A Kir has approximately 163 calories, with 13.2% ABV and 7g of sugar.
